Walking Down Memory Lane
Don't you love it when you have a day where you just have a whole bunch of memories come into play? Well ... today I had one of those days.
I was supervising at a Volleyball tournament today. Well, at the end of it I had the chance to watch. Everytime they "spiked" the ball (I hope that is the right term), it brought me right back to when I was a little girl going to watch my cousins in a volleyball tournament. It was always fun to go with Aunt Roslyn in the van with all of the volleyball girls. Seeing the players spike the ball ... I could see my cousin Kim getting the job done.
Then I was working in the canteen for a bit of it. It once again brought me back to all the tournaments that I watched. It was fun especially when you were allowed to buy stuff at the canteen. I remember mostly the canteen they used to have in Whitbourne... I remember that one being the best. Roslyn always bought me something.
Ok... so I am afraid of balls flying in the gym. Super duperly afraid! Funny hey? Anyway, everytime a ball came towards me it reminded me of Kenneth. Not so sure why? But it did!
Hopefully I'll get to see him one of these days!
Then some of the music that was playing brought me right back to Burry Heights. I could just picture us doing those early morning exercises. Boy, weren't they fun?
Anyway, it is so nice to stroll down memory lane sometimes. It is just nice to reminence about things and to see all the blessings that we are given!
